The AMD EPYC 7452 features 32 processor cores and has the capability to manage 64 threads concurrently. It was released in Q3/2019 and belongs to the 2 generation of the AMD EPYC series. To use the AMD EPYC 7452, you'll need a motherboard with a SP3 socket.

CPU Cores and Base Frequency

The AMD EPYC 7452 has 32 CPU cores and can calculate 64 threads in parallel. The clock frequency of the AMD EPYC 7452 is 2.35 GHz and turbo frequency for one core is 3.35 GHz. The number of CPU cores greatly affects the speed of the processor and is an important performance indicator.

Thermal Management

The processor has a thermal design power (TDP) of 155 W watts. TDP indicates the cooling solution needed to effectively manage the processor's heat. It generally provides an approximate indication of the actual power consumption of the CPU itself.

Technical details

The AMD EPYC 7452 is manufactured using a 7 nm process. A smaller manufacturing process indicates a more contemporary and energy-efficient CPU. In total, this processor boasts a generous 128.0 MB cache. A substantial cache can significantly enhance the processor's performance, particularly in scenarios like gaming.
